摘要
Selected species of the tribe Antidesmeae (Euphorbiaceae, subfamily Phyllanthoideae) have been screened for antidesmone occurrence and its content by quantitative HPLC (UV) and qualitative LC-MS/MS analysis. The LC-MS analysis allowing the additional detection of 17,18-bis-nor-antidestrione, 18-nor-antidesnione, 8-dihydroantidesmone and 8-deoxoantidestrione was carried Out ill the selected reaction monitoring (SRM) mode. Leaf material from herbarium Specimens of 13 Antides,a spp., H yeronima alchorneoides and Thecacoris stenopetala fall subtribe Antidesminae), as well as Maesohotrya berteri, Aporosa octandra (both Scepinae) and Uapaca robynsii (Uapacinae) were analysed. Additionally, freshly collected samples of different plant parts of two Antidesma spp. were investigated to ensure the significance of the results on herbarium specimens and to compare the antidesmone content in bark, root and leaves. Antidesmone could be unambiguously identified in 12 of 13 Antidesma spp., as well as in the two other investigated genera of subtribe Antidesminae, in levels of up to 65 mg/kg plant dry weight. Antidesmone was not found ill specimens from other subtribes. Antidesmone-derived compounds occur in much lower concentrations than antidesirione. (C) 2002 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served.
